Ok my first ever hatch is on day 20 and I am going crazy. The thing is for some reason I have a bad feeling like I haven't done something right. I candled often and always seen movement and what I thought I should see. But when I candled a few days ago I didn't see any. There was just a dark area in the egg. So my question is can I candle on day 20? And if so what should I see. Thanks for any help.

If you saw a dark mass in the egg, then that's the chick, and you don't want to open the 'bator at all. I know it's hard, but don't do it. I didn't think I was going to get ANY quail at all... I was SURE I had killed them all. But I can't candle quail - too small/dark shelled - so I had to just trust and leave them be. Now I have one little guy, and hopefully more in the next couple of days. I had two staggered batches going.
